In previous versions, Screaming Frog’s Log Analyzer allowed you to filter by status codes (200, 301, 404, etc.). However, version 18.4 introduces granular filtering by (GET, POST, HEAD, PUT, DELETE) – something previously reserved for command-line tools like awk or grep .
